Understanding Material Choices

According to Jane Thompson, an interior designer specializing in sustainable materials, “It's important to look for products made from recycled or rapidly renewable resources.” This approach not only reduces waste but also minimizes the carbon footprint associated with manufacturing new materials. Many eco-friendly interior wall panel ideas utilize bamboo, reclaimed wood, or recycled metal, which are both stylish and sustainable.

Evaluate Certifications

Mark Reynolds, a sustainability consultant, emphasizes the significance of certifications like LEED (Leadership in Energy and Environmental Design) and FSC (Forest Stewardship Council). “Look for panels that have these certifications, as they guarantee that the materials meet strict environmental standards,” he notes. This can help assure homeowners that they’re choosing products that are not only eco-friendly but also safe for indoor air quality.

Functionality and Durability

Alongside aesthetics, functionality is key. Construction expert Kevin Chan points out, “Choose panels that are designed for longevity. Many eco-friendly materials can stand the test of time, reducing the need for frequent replacements.” Opting for durable solutions helps in not only saving costs in the long run but also in lessening environmental impact through reduced resource consumption.

Cost Considerations

Investment is often a concern when choosing eco-friendly options. Financial advisor Nina Gonzalez advises, “Consider the lifecycle cost of materials. While some eco-friendly panels may have a higher initial cost, their durability and energy-saving qualities can lead to savings over time.” It’s crucial to assess these factors to make an informed decision that aligns with your budget and values.

Installation and Maintenance

Lastly, regarding installation and maintenance, contractor David Lee states, “It’s important to hire skilled professionals who understand the nuances of eco-friendly materials. Proper installation ensures that the panels perform as expected.” Additionally, maintenance can vary between materials, so understanding the care required is essential for longevity.
